🌿🍷🇳🇿 Embark on an extraordinary journey with Professor Terry Hunt as we explore the ancient landscapes, vibrant culture, and breathtaking beauty of Aotearoa (New Zealand).

Our adventure begins in Auckland, where we'll gather for a welcome dinner before journeying through the Bay of Islands, discovering sacred Māori sites, historic settlements, and some of New Zealand's most significant archaeological treasures.

As we travel south, we'll experience the geothermal wonders and living Māori culture of Rotorua, savor exceptional wines on Waiheke Island, and delve into New Zealand's fascinating history through engaging lectures with Professor Hunt.

The journey continues across the spectacular South Island, where we'll ride the iconic TranzAlpine Railway, cruise through the breathtaking fjords of Milford Sound, and soak in the beauty of Queenstown and the Southern Alps.

This carefully curated itinerary truly does it all—rich cultural experiences, world-class food and wine, extraordinary landscapes, and meaningful exploration.

Māori History/Archeology

Mt. Eden (Maungawhau) Crater and Māori Pā Site, Ruapekapeka Pā, Waitangi Treaty Grounds (New Zealand’s most important historic site and the birthplace of the nation),

Māori Culture/Traditions

Traditional Māori cultural performance at Te Puia (Music and dance performances, traditional storytelling, Hāngī feast (cooked using geothermal steam), and evening experience around Pōhutu Geyser)

Museums & Culture

Auckland War Memorial Museum, Te Papa Tongarewa (Museum of New Zealand), Hundertwasser Museum and Wairau Māori Art Gallery

Historic Settlements

Kerikeri Mission House: One of New Zealand’s oldest European settlements and an important place in early Māori-European relations

Academic Insights

Educational sessions with Professor Terry Hunt and special lecture with Dr. Janet Wilmshurst on New Zealand ecological history
